Proper noun
    
Velia f
- A taxonomic genus within the family Veliidae – riffle bugs, smaller water striders, broad-shouldered water striders.
 
Hypernyms
    
- (genus): Eukaryota – superkingdom; Animalia – kingdom; Bilateria – subkingdom; Protostomia – infrakingdom; Ecdysozoa – superphylum; Arthropoda – phylum; Hexapoda - subphylum; Insecta - class; Pterygota - subclass; Neoptera - infraclass; Paraneoptera - superorder; Hemiptera - order; Heteroptera - suborder; Gerromorpha - infraorder; Gerroidea - superfamily; Veliidae - family; Microveliinae - subfamily; Microveliini - tribe

Latin
    
    Etymology
    
From Ancient Greek Ἐλέα (Eléa).
Pronunciation
    
- (Classical) IPA(key): /ˈu̯e.li.a/, [ˈu̯ɛlʲiä]
 - (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): /ˈve.li.a/, [ˈvɛːliä]
 
Proper noun
    
Velia f sg (genitive Veliae); first declension
- a Greek colony, situated on the shores of the Tyrrhenian Sea between Paestum and Buxentum
 
Declension
    
First-declension noun, with locative, singular only.
| Case | Singular | 
|---|---|
| Nominative | Velia | 
| Genitive | Veliae | 
| Dative | Veliae | 
| Accusative | Veliam | 
| Ablative | Veliā | 
| Vocative | Velia | 
| Locative | Veliae |
